The choice of a Coxeter element of W is equivalent to the choice of an acyclic orientation of the Coxeter diagram of W. In this paper we define a more general notion of Q-sortable elements where Q is an arbitrary orientation of the diagram and show that the key properties of c-sortable elements carry over to the Q-sortable elements. The proofs of these properties rely on reduction to the acyclic case but the reductions are nontrivial in particular the proofs rely on a subtle combinatorial property of the weak order as it relates to orientations of the Coxeter diagram. The c-sortable elements are closely tied to the combinatorics of cluster algebras with an acyclic seed the ultimate motivation behind this paper is to extend this connection beyond the acyclic case. 1 Introduction The results of this paper are purely combinatorial but are motivated by questions in the theory of cluster algebras. To define a cluster algebra one requires the input data of a skew-symmetrizable integer matrix that is to say an n X n integer matrix B and a vector of positive integers Ố1 . ỏn such that ỏiBij ỏjBji. For the experts we are discussing cluster algebras without coefficients. This input data defines a recursion which produces among other things a set of cluster variables. Each cluster variable is a rational function in x1 . xn and the cluster variables are grouped into overlapping sets of size n called clusters.
